Almost everyone can shave strokes from their golf scores, but high-handicappers (15-up) have the opportunity to make the most significant improvement. The reason is simple: high-handicappers don’t hit many greens in regulation; consequently, they have to depend more on their short games.
Three short shots comprise the most important stroke-saving strategy: (1) chip shots, (2) pitch shots, (3) and sand shots. Don’t just grab your shag bag and head for the practice area to work on these shots. You must have the correct fundamentals; practicing poor habits is counterproductive.
Ask for advice from talented players or your club professional before you begin working on your short game. You can also learn the fundamentals from books, magazines, and videos, but nothing beats hands-on help.

If you think that you can get better at golf all on your own, then you probably have a rude awakening coming. Though much of improvement at golf comes down to hard work, this won’t help you if you don’t have a person telling you what to improve upon. That is where a golf swing coach comes into play. A golf swing coach will break down your individual swing and let you know exactly where you are going wrong.
This is invaluable advice that can really put your golf swing in perspective. No matter how hard you work, it is going to be hard for you to know exactly what you are doing wrong. A golf swing coach can take a look at what you’re doing and fix it from the outside.
